Oracle经典教程:从安装到PL/SQL全面解析

需积分: 0 2 下载量 81 浏览量 更新于2024-07-25 收藏 3.26MB PDF 举报
Oracle经典教程是一份详尽的指南,涵盖了Oracle数据库的基础知识与进阶技能。该教程主要分为以下几个部分: 1. Oracle简介:首先介绍了Oracle数据库系统的基本概念,与SQL Server等传统关系型数据库的区别在于Oracle以对象为导向,强调表的管理和数据存储。它不仅包含基础的数据库元素如表、记录,还强调了Oracle在存储和管理数据方面的特性。 2. 安装与配置:教程详细指导了Oracle的安装过程,确保读者能够正确设置和配置Oracle环境,以便后续的操作。 3. 客户端工具:讲解了如何使用Oracle的客户端工具与服务器进行交互,包括连接、登录以及管理工具的使用。 4. 服务与管理:涵盖了Oracle服务的启动、关闭和维护,这对于理解数据库的运行机制至关重要。 5. 用户与权限:介绍了Oracle数据库中的用户管理,包括创建用户、分配角色以及权限的授予和撤销,确保数据安全。 6. SQL数据操作与查询:深入解析了SQL语言,包括数据类型、创建表和约束、DML(数据操纵语言)操作、操作符、高级查询以及子查询和常用函数的使用。 7. 表空间与数据库对象:讲解了Oracle数据库对象的分类,如同义词、序列、视图、索引和表空间的管理,这些都是数据库设计和优化的关键内容。 8. PL/SQL程序设计:PL/SQL是Oracle的编程语言,教程涵盖了PL/SQL的基本概念、块结构、数据类型、条件控制、循环控制、动态SQL执行以及异常处理。 9. Oracle在.NET平台的应用:通过回顾ADO.NET,展示了如何使用.NET框架连接Oracle数据库,并在抽象工厂模式中集成Oracle功能。 10. 数据库导入导出:介绍了Oracle的数据迁移工具,包括EXP(导出数据)和IMP(导入数据),以及处理常见问题的方法。 Oracle经典教程提供了全面的学习路径,适合初学者入门Oracle数据库,同时也为有一定经验的开发者提供深入理解和实践操作的机会。通过学习,读者将掌握Oracle的核心技术,为数据库管理、编程和应用开发打下坚实的基础。